Why This Record Matters
Where You Want To Be was Taking Back Sunday’s second studio album and marked the recorded debut of guitarist/vocalist Fred Mascherino and bassist Matt Rubano with the band. The album reached No. 3 on the Billboard 200 and includes “A Decade Under The Influence” and “This Photograph Is Proof (I Know You Know).” Lou Giordano and Todd Parker handled production, recording, and mixing.

Collector Note
This 2013 U.S. Victory Records VR228 repress is the second pressing on black vinyl, pressed by Rainbo Records with S-84777 and S-84778 job numbers in the runouts. Mark Richardson cut the lacquers at Prairie Cat Mastering, identified by PCMJR in the supplied matrices, and this copy retains its original lyric/credits insert and remains in shrink wrap.
